Output 34d75e8030083d207015628e4433b9d49c6897e51a666b073c46e9682b768d66:2

value
117867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86a7db563c83a8f183641f0c0a1e9292d8d8a0ed OP_EQUAL
address
3Dy1Z9Ew4ApAnHPaFCow1nKN29PGy5jGCn
transaction
34d75e8030083d207015628e4433b9d49c6897e51a666b073c46e9682b768d66
spent
true